Many years previously I developed FaceSpan 3 under contract for its owner. As part of that effort I became impressed with FaceSpan’s power and simplicity. FaceSpan 3 was successful, for a development tool, and even received an Apple Design Award at that year’s Worldwide Developers Conference. Sadly, after my involvement with the product ended, FaceSpan fell into disrepair and did not make the leap to Mac OS X. FaceSpan’s developer finally produced FaceSpan 4 which was [too] little [too] late and not as successful as hoped for.
- excerpt adapted from Mark Alldritt's blog.
FaceSpan is an application package that allows you to create sophisticated graphic user interfaces for AppleScripts and save them as stand-alone applications, thus broadening the possibilities for creating custom utilities, application integration and product prototyping.
It includes editors for scripting your application, constructing and scripting windows and menus, as well as a management environment through which you can inspect, edit, duplicate, and delete each application’s interface components and resources.

The fourth download contains a series of sample FaceSpan apps that can be observed from within FaceSpan itself. They include Resource Reporter to find resources that might conflict with FaceSpan or another injected runtime, The Script Sniffer to identify all items that lack scripts in the open FaceSpan project, a sample scheduling app called FaceSpan OnTimevx.1, and FaceSpan QuickCard to show off FaceSpan's drawing and printing capabilities. All have been sourced from the FaceSpan website and confirmed to work with FaceSpan 3.0, and remain in the original StuffIt and binhexed archives within this zip file.
